Bit Fields allow the packing of data in a structure. This is especially useful when memory or data storage is at a premium. Typical examples: Packing several objects into a …

Web32 bit and 64 bit refer to the addressable memory. A 32 bit computer can only use about 4 GB of RAM, whereas a 64 bit computer can use about 16 exabytes of RAM. 64 bit computers can often do more calculations per second, so they are faster. WebThis byte has 8 bits. Each of those bits could be used as a flag. For example, suppose the computer regularly checks the status of 8 pieces of hardware in turn. Each piece of hardware can be assigned a particular bit in this byte. If the hardware is functioning correctly, the relavant bit is made a 0 (we talk about 'resetting' a bit when we ...

A bit can hold only one of two values: 0 or 1, corresponding to the electrical values of off or on, respectively. Because bits are so small, you rarely work with information one bit at a time.
